From the juicy tenderness of a ribeye to the leaner, but flavorful flank steak, the cut you choose will influence your cooking method and overall experience. Consider factors like budget, desired fat content, and cooking time.

A perfect sear is key to a flavorful steak. Get your pan scorching hot before adding the meat. This creates a beautiful crust while locking in the juices.

Different cuts benefit from different cooking methods. Ribeyes and New York strips thrive with a pan sear or reverse sear (cooking in the oven first, then searing). Flank steak excels when marinated and cooked quickly over high heat.
